2008 Lexus RX vs. 2008 Lexus ES

To start off, both 2008 Lexus RX and 2008 Lexus ES were released in the same year (2008).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 3,456 cc (6 cylinders), 2008 Lexus RX is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, both vehicles can yield 272 horse power. So under normal driving conditions, the acceleration of both vehicles should be relatively similar.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Lexus RX weights approximately 380 kg more than 2008 Lexus ES.

Because 2008 Lexus RX is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2008 Lexus ES.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2008 Lexus RX will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Lexus ES (344 Nm @ 4700 RPM) has 2 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Lexus RX. (342 Nm @ 4700 RPM). This means 2008 Lexus ES will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Lexus RX.
